Real Estate Prices & Overview

Ocean Pkwy / Avenue N median real estate price is $838,837, which is more expensive than 62.3% of the neighborhoods in New York and 81.4% of the neighborhoods in the U.S.

The average rental price in Ocean Pkwy / Avenue N is currently $3,354, based on NeighborhoodScout's exclusive analysis. The average rental cost in this neighborhood is higher than 62.3% of the neighborhoods in New York.

Ocean Pkwy / Avenue N is a densely urban neighborhood (based on population density) located in Brooklyn, New York.

Ocean Pkwy / Avenue N real estate is primarily made up of small (studio to two bedroom) to medium sized (three or four bedroom) apartment complexes/high-rise apartments and small apartment buildings. Most of the residential real estate is occupied by a mixture of owners and renters. Many of the residences in the Ocean Pkwy / Avenue N neighborhood are older, well-established, built between 1940 and 1969. A number of residences were also built before 1940.

Vacant apartments or homes are a major fact of life in Ocean Pkwy / Avenue N. The current real estate vacancy rate here is 19.9%. This is higher than the rate of vacancies in 86.6% of all U.S. neighborhoods. In addition, most vacant housing here is vacant year round. Modes of Transportation

If you like to ride the train to work, this neighborhood may be for you. NeighborhoodScout's research revealed that 41.3% of the Ocean Pkwy / Avenue N neighborhood's commuters ride the train to and from work each day, which is more than we found in 98.9% of America's neighborhoods.

Also, more people in Ocean Pkwy / Avenue N choose to walk to work each day (17.5%) than almost any neighborhood in America. If you are attracted to the idea of being able to walk to work, this neighborhood could be a good choice.

But NeighborhoodScout's exclusive analysis shows that the Ocean Pkwy / Avenue N neighborhood has a highly unusual pattern of car ownership. 50.9% of the households in this neighborhood don't own a car at all. This is more carless households than NeighborhoodScout found in 98.8% of U.S. neighborhoods.

Real Estate

The Ocean Pkwy / Avenue N neighborhood is very densely populated compared to most U.S. neighborhoods. In fact, with 48,374 persons per square mile in the neighborhood, it is more packed with people than 98.4% of the nation's neighborhoods. Diversity

Did you know that the Ocean Pkwy / Avenue N neighborhood has more Ukrainian and Arab ancestry people living in it than nearly any neighborhood in America? It's true! In fact, 13.4% of this neighborhood's residents have Ukrainian ancestry and 8.3% have Arab ancestry.

Ocean Pkwy / Avenue N is also pretty special linguistically. Significantly, 1.3% of its residents five years old and above primarily speak Russian at home. While this may seem like a small percentage, it is higher than 97.2% of the neighborhoods in America.

The neighbors in the Ocean Pkwy / Avenue N neighborhood in Brooklyn are middle-income, making it a moderate income neighborhood. NeighborhoodScout's exclusive analysis reveals that this neighborhood has a higher income than 41.3% of the neighborhoods in America. With 42.6% of the children here below the federal poverty line, this neighborhood has a higher rate of childhood poverty than 90.6% of U.S. neighborhoods.

What we choose to do for a living reflects who we are. Each neighborhood has a different mix of occupations represented, and together these tell you about the neighborhood and help you understand if this neighborhood may fit your lifestyle.

In the Ocean Pkwy / Avenue N neighborhood, 38.5% of the working population is employed in executive, management, and professional occupations. The second most important occupational group in this neighborhood is manufacturing and laborer occupations, with 25.0% of the residents employed. Other residents here are employed in sales and service jobs, from major sales accounts, to working in fast food restaurants (22.9%), and 13.5% in clerical, assistant, and tech support occupations.

Languages

The languages spoken by people in this neighborhood are diverse. These are tabulated as the languages people preferentially speak when they are at home with their families. The most common language spoken in the Ocean Pkwy / Avenue N neighborhood is English, spoken by 47.1% of households. Other important languages spoken here include Spanish, Arabic and Chinese.

In the Ocean Pkwy / Avenue N neighborhood in Brooklyn, NY, residents most commonly identify their ethnicity or ancestry as Ukrainian (13.4%). There are also a number of people of Mexican ancestry (10.3%), and residents who report Arab roots (8.3%), and some of the residents are also of Dominican ancestry (3.8%), along with some Asian ancestry residents (3.6%), among others. In addition, 42.7% of the residents of this neighborhood were born in another country.

The greatest number of commuters in Ocean Pkwy / Avenue N neighborhood spend between 45 minutes and one hour commuting one-way to work (41.9% of working residents), longer and tougher than most commutes in America.

Here most residents (41.3%) take the train to get to work. In addition, quite a number also drive alone in a private automobile to get to work (25.3%) and 17.5% of residents also hop out the door and walk to work for their daily commute.
